The direct sum β¨iβViβ consists of tuples with finite support in the algebraic case; Hilbert direct sums complete square-summable families under the natural inner product.

An indexed family of vector spaces has a direct sum characterized by finitely supported components and the coproduct universal property.

Fock space is a Hilbert direct sum of zero-, one-, and many-particle tensor-power sectors.
